MURRAY E. NELSON GOVERNMENT CENTER
KEY LARGO, FL

In 2009, Xavier Cortada created Native Canopy, eight double sided digital tapestries for the Nelson Center in Key Largo, FL. Commissioned by the Monroe County Art in Public Places, the tapestries serve as reminders of place and markers of time, climbing up the staircase of the building reminding visitors of climbing the branch of a tree.
